So here it goes my first conversion of a Bunny Suit for 7b Bombshell with a weight support.
Bracelets uses a ring slot , in case someone is wondering.

 

And I think I had enough of pantyhoses right now +calm.png.

 

There are two weird bugs that I was unable to resolve:

  • You will get lots of clippings on the knees with more flexible poses.
  • Feet around fingers likes to get distorted if a custom pose uses these bones.


I've tested vanilla animations plus few of the custom walk/running/idle replacers and it works fine. Not sure how it looks in combat.
Basicaly every standing/sitting/laying pose works properly without clippings. ( just try to avoid "kneel" poses ).
What about other bodies? First I want to be sure this one is done properly.

 


If you have any suggestions on how I could improve suit and myself please let me know or if you find any strange bugs.

 

All the Credits goes to the ANK team for original model and authors of Bodyslide 2.

Hi, i dont understant how to get it in the game. I write help bunny, but what after it ?

 

when you type. help bunny

you should get a item number for the suit.

Then you just  type

Player.additem xxxxxx 1

 xxx is the item number and 1 is the number of suits you want to add
